Just putting it out there, not that I have any experience at all or any position to come from, but we're not back in 2004 when the hoon law didn't exist and dyno's were so expensive it was rare for a shop to have one... I wouldn't risk my licence, my car or my engine on a road tune for anything other than cruise tuning. And unless you are looking at doing top speed runs with full load on at least 4th gear (5spd box) and 5th gear (6spd box) the tune will not be suitable should you ever go to a track day.

This isn't negative, its the real world. All who want to spend money willfully putting important parts of their life at risk feel free, and anyone who says but its just my street car or daily drive, I don't drive it hard... repeat once you hear big end noise and are crying because you're catching the bus to work.

Anyone who knows me will realise where I'm coming from and hopefully see this as a true warning.... its not like I've ever been involved with a tuning company or maybe been pushing the limits of subaru's for a while...
